1. Choose the Right Location
The first step in creating a vacation home is to select the perfect location. Consider factors such as climate, scenery, and accessibility. For example, if you want a beachside vacation home, place it near the beach or a lake. If you prefer a mountain retreat, look for a location with scenic views and easy access to hiking trails.
2. Decorate with Vacation-Themed Furniture
To make your Sims feel like they are on vacation, it’s essential to decorate the house with vacation-themed furniture and decor. Look for items like beach chairs, hammocks, outdoor grills, and themed wall art. Don’t forget to include a pool or hot tub if you want to simulate a luxurious vacation experience.
3. Add Vacation Activities
To enhance the vacation experience, include activities that your Sims can enjoy. For a beachside home, consider adding a volleyball net, a surfboard, or a beach umbrella. If you’re simulating a mountain cabin, include hiking gear, a fireplace, and cozy blankets. For a rustic farmhouse, think about adding a barn, a garden, and a rustic kitchen.
4. Create a Scenic Outdoor Area
A well-designed outdoor area can make your vacation home feel even more inviting. Add a patio, a deck, or a porch with comfortable seating. Plant flowers, trees, and shrubs to create a picturesque setting. If you have a pool or hot tub, make sure to include a poolside area with loungers and a tanning bed.
5. Personalize the Interior
While it’s important to have a vacation theme, don’t forget to personalize the interior. Add your Sims’ favorite furniture, artwork, and decorations to make the vacation home feel like a true home away from home. Consider their hobbies and interests when choosing the decor, ensuring that they have everything they need to relax and enjoy their stay.
6. Add Vacation Features
To make your vacation home even more immersive, consider adding vacation features such as a home theater, a game room, or a spa area. These features can provide your Sims with a variety of activities to enjoy during their stay.
7. Keep Maintenance in Mind
As with any house, it’s important to keep maintenance in mind when creating a vacation home. Ensure that your Sims have access to cleaning supplies and tools for maintaining the property. This will help keep the vacation home looking pristine and encourage your Sims to return for more visits.
